Transaction 64f7ffca33d2bb18bb206a62a2bd656f66486ecd53e6a01620641a4fb263850b

1 Input
2 Outputs
  • 64f7ffca33d2bb18bb206a62a2bd656f66486ecd53e6a01620641a4fb263850b:0
  • value  305000
    address  1622PPKUYw1LKWFzkJp3HsTGEiWZy19wGL
  • 64f7ffca33d2bb18bb206a62a2bd656f66486ecd53e6a01620641a4fb263850b:1
  • value  12746
    address  bc1qvwgcuy6wkf6umm2sdmchtn5qg3yewp7rtcncrx